Café Sonneveld
Café Sonneveld is a traditional Dutch pub-style restaurant on the picturesque Egelantiersgracht. Its relaxed atmosphere, friendly service and walls filled with photographs of legendary entertainer Wim Sonneveld perfectly capture the warm character of the Jordaan.
The tender, generously portioned spareribs are one of the highlights of the menu. Marinated for plenty of flavour and served with salad and several sauces, they are an excellent choice for a satisfying dinner. You can also order Dutch favourites such as stamppot, beef croquettes, calf’s liver with bacon and onions or the café’s popular half roast chicken.
Pair your meal with a cold beer, a glass of jenever or a traditional kopstoot. Whether you visit for lunch, dinner or an afternoon beside the canal, Café Sonneveld offers genuine Amsterdam conviviality without unnecessary fuss.
